WebTax liens. A Chapter 7 bankruptcy discharge of income taxes wipes out the personal obligation to pay the tax and prevents the taxing authority from going after your bank account or wages. However, tax liens, also known as secured taxes, will remain attached to your property. This rule applies only to tax liens recorded against your property ... WebJan 29, 2024 · Under Chapter 7, you may lose the first tax refund that’s due after discharge, or some of it, because it’s a refund of money earned before discharge. If some of the refund is from income earned after filing for bankruptcy, you keep it. For instance, if you filed for bankruptcy on June 30, 2024, and your income didn’t change the entire ...
